3-Year-Old Boy Among 3 Killed in Halloween DUI Crash in Long Beach
LONG BEACH, CA (October 31, 2019) – A 3-year-old boy has died along with his parents following a DUI crash Halloween night in Long Beach, authorities said.
The fatal crash happened just before 10:00 p.m. near Los Cerritos Park on Country Club Drive.
Police said a family of three, which was trick-or-treating at the time, had been run down on a sidewalk by a 2002 Toyota Sequoia.
Paramedics rushed all three victims to hospitals for treatment. The boy succumbed to his injuries on Saturday morning.
A GoFundMe page identified the young victim as Omar Awaida. His parents were Raihan Awaida and Joseph Awaida.
The driver of the SUV, 20-year-old Carlo Navarro of Long Beach, was arrested at the scene. He was later booked on suspicion of DUI and gross vehicular manslaughter, authorities said.
Investigation of this crash is ongoing.
